Summary

The Kingman/Norwich Innovative Learning Grant supports USD 331 teachers in enhancing innovative learning for the 2025-2026 school year. This grant aims to provide resources for enriching classroom experiences, professional development for educators, and accessibility to arts and leadership training. It targets initiatives that offer economically feasible opportunities for students and staff, fostering creativity and innovation within the curriculum.

Overview

Kingman/Norwich Innovative Learning Grant This grant opportunity is available to USD 331 teachers for any of the following criteria to be implemented in the 2025-2026 School Year. Increase innovative learning in the classroom, building, or district curriculum. Provide opportunities to students that otherwise are not economically feasible. Professional learning opportunities for staff that foster innovative learning. Provide exposure to arts & humanities, career opportunities, or leadership training to the students and staff. Provide innovative learning tools in the classroom that otherwise are not economically feasible.
